11 lis 2022 · Step 1: Open the Google Slider, create a presentation, and press Insert. Step 2: Click the Video to add the video file you want to go into a repetition. Step 3: After adding the video to the slide, right-click the video. Step 4: Then options will appear; click the Loop to activate the repetitive effect on the video.

7 sie 2020 · To make a video loop in Google Slides all you have to do is present your slides then right-click on the video. When you right-click on it you’ll be able to choose an option to loop the video. Watch my short video to see how it’s done.
